Latest Patents

Among his latest patents is a method for fitting a tubular roll shell in a paper or board machine. This method utilizes hydrostatic slide bearing elements to support the roll shell on a stationary roll shaft. The slide bearing elements are hydraulically loaded, allowing for precise adjustments in response to loading conditions. Another notable patent involves a method for providing a roll for a paper machine with sliding bearings, which ensures effective radial and axial fitting of the roll mantle. This invention also features a control valve system that automatically compensates for external loading, enhancing the operational stability of the roll.
